Hyderabad RGIA Airport on High Alert

On Sunday, the Rajiv Gandhi International Airport (RGIA) , Hyderabad was placed on high alert after the central intelligence agencies issued alert about an email regarding flight hijacking. The Police said that they have strengthened the security and increased airport checking and patrolling after the alert was issued.

B. Anuradha, the Assistant Commissioner of Police, Shamshabad had said, “An email was received by the Mumbai police from a woman alerting them about a possible flight hijacking at Mumbai, Hyderabad and Chennai airports on Sunday. We are on high alert and CISF personnel stepped up the security set-up at the airport.”

To increase security, the Octopus team was dispatched to the place and put on around the clock alert. The CISF personnel said, “Security has also been tightened at various places like the parking lot, departure and arrival blocks. Sniffer dogs and bomb disposal squads were roped in for elaborate checks.” The RGIA is still under tight security and no incidents have been reported yet.
